Saleyards committee established

An advisory committee has finally been appointed to oversee the operations of the Millicent cattle saleyards.

After some delay, Wattle Range Council has now filled all 11 positions and established the section 41 committee at its February monthly meeting.

The council itself is represented by its Mayor Des Noll and councillors Dale Price, Deb Agnew and Moira Neagle.

The stock firms have Owen Merrett (Merrett Livestock), John Chay (John Chay & co), Scott Altschwager (Elders) and Jim Noonan (Nutrien) as their representatives.

The other stakeholders are Furner grazier Steve Bellinger (vendor and buyer), Neville Copping (yarding contractor) and Jason Walker (trucking operator).

The new committee will serve until November 2026 and replaces the previous Working Group.

All of its decisions have to be ratified by the council.
